Output d61c28efbb5a9a9fd7c09799f2e9b9f7f3dac380037e08652f5300bf4952fd75:2

value
268518584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b49ae4405b52ad498f73e82915a493b43557ecf OP_EQUAL
address
3Qbho7u4nWKGiKKKZjsuqkDcXUuwM4wZ58
transaction
d61c28efbb5a9a9fd7c09799f2e9b9f7f3dac380037e08652f5300bf4952fd75
spent
true